| From: | Igor Korot <ikorot01(at)gmail(dot)com> |
|---|---|
| To: | PostgreSQL ODBC list <pgsql-odbc(at)postgresql(dot)org> |
| Subject: | Fwd: ODBC fails to recognize event trigger removal |
| Date: | 2025-11-23 18:17:36 |
| Message-ID: | CA+FnnTwQVuab9rcZL-oSDqBGwdXBAbSsanojF0Pvb2yTXJX5oA@mail.gmail.com |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-general pgsql-odbc |
Originally sent to PostgreSQL general ML.
Thank you.
---------- Forwarded message ---------
From: Igor Korot <ikorot01(at)gmail(dot)com>
Date: Sun, Nov 23, 2025 at 4:44 AM
Subject: ODBC fails to recognize event trigger removal
To: pgsql-generallists.postgresql.org <pgsql-general(at)lists(dot)postgresql(dot)org>
Hi, ALL,
[code]
postgres=# CREATE OR REPLACE FUNCTION __watch_schema_changes() RETURNS
event_trigger LANGUAGE plpgsql AS $$ BEGIN NOTIFY tg_tag; END; $$;
CREATE FUNCTION
postgres=# CREATE EVENT TRIGGER schema_change_notify ON
ddl_command_end WHEN TAG IN('CREATE TABLE', 'ALTER TABLE', 'DROP
TABLE', 'CREATE INDEX', 'DROP INDEX') EXECUTE PROCEDURE
__watch_schema_changes();
CREATE EVENT TRIGGER
postgres=# DROP EVENT TRIGGER schema_change_notify CASCADE;
DROP EVENT TRIGGER
postgres=# \q
igor(at)WaylandGnome ~/unixODBC-2.3.12 $ isql postgres postgres wasqra123
+---------------------------------------+
| Connected! |
| |
| sql-statement |
| help [tablename] |
| echo [string] |
| quit |
| |
+---------------------------------------+
SQL> CREATE OR REPLACE FUNCTION __watch_schema_changes() RETURNS
event_trigger LANGUAGE plpgsql AS $$ BEGIN NOTIFY tg_tag; END; $$;
SQLRowCount returns -1
SQL> CREATE EVENT TRIGGER schema_change_notify ON ddl_command_end WHEN
TAG IN('CREATE TABLE', 'ALTER TABLE', 'DROP TABLE', 'CREATE INDEX',
'DROP INDEX') EXECUTE PROCEDURE __watch_schema_changes();
[ISQL]ERROR: Could not SQLExecute
SQL> quit
igor(at)WaylandGnome ~/unixODBC-2.3.12 $
[/code]
Server version 16.2
Driver version 11.1
Anybody aware of this?
Thank you.
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Adrian Klaver | 2025-11-23 21:36:24 | Re: ODBC fails to recognize event trigger removal |
| Previous Message | Adrian Klaver | 2025-11-23 16:41:44 | Re: ODBC fails to recognize event trigger removal |
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Adrian Klaver | 2025-11-23 21:36:24 | Re: ODBC fails to recognize event trigger removal |
| Previous Message | Adrian Klaver | 2025-11-23 16:41:44 | Re: ODBC fails to recognize event trigger removal |